Ticket: DEDUP-412 — Connection failures during customer record dedup

The Larkspur dedup job started failing overnight with pool exhaustion errors. It merges duplicate customer records in batches of 500, but the batch worker isn't releasing connections after a merge conflict, so the pool drains within twenty minutes. Proposed fix: wrap merges in a try/finally release and cap retries at three. For the sync, reproduce against staging using the connection string below.

primary connection of bagep-kaweg = clickhouse://rusdor_svc:3TXlgH7O8DuUYI@db-ae3f.zarqelgrid.internal:5432/zordor

14:22 — Offline sync regression confirmed (Terrapath field-survey app)

At 14:22 the on-call engineer reproduced the data-loss path: surveys saved while offline were marked synced once connectivity returned, even when the upload was rejected. The queue flush skipped the server acknowledgement check introduced in the previous sprint. Release manager note: the fix must ship before the coastal survey season. The offending build is identified by the token recorded below.

session token of kawif-fawig = htk31_f3f599be2b1a34affb1efa8d0feccf8

For this week's sync: intermittent resolution failures hit the Petrelhurst gateway when the upstream resolver pool rotates. Symptoms are sporadic five-second timeouts on outbound calls, roughly every forty minutes, never on retry. Mitigation so far: pinning the resolver list and raising the negative-cache floor, which cut failures by ninety percent but did not eliminate them. Before making further changes, confirm your node matches the expected resolver configuration, reproduced below for comparison.

service settings:
PRAIX_LOG_LEVEL=error
PRAIX_METRICS_HOST=metrics.praix.qorvelcorp.corp
PRAIX_POOL_SIZE=16

# Hey, welcome aboard! This env file drives the undo/redo stack in Sketchloom,
# our diagram editor. The history service keeps a rolling buffer of canvas ops,
# and HISTORY_DEPTH below caps how many steps users can walk back. Don't crank
# it past 500 or the snapshot store on the Fernwick cluster gets grumpy.
# Redo entries are pruned whenever a new op lands, so no config needed there.
# One more thing: the history service authenticates to the snapshot store with
# a signing secret, which goes on the next line.

env line for fafof-fahag: LEDGER_TOKEN5=f8790